Ad Code

Responsive Advertisement

Membuat Repositori Local Menggunakan File ISO Image di Debian 7

Hai.. Kali ini saya akan berbagi pengalaman tentang membuat Repositori Local menggunakan file ISO Image. Repositori ini, beriisikan packet-packet aplikasi yang bisa digunakan dalam OS Linux. Keuntungan dari Repositori Local ini adalah tidak perlu adanya koneksi internet untuk Mengupdate repositori maupun menginstall aplikasi untuk dipasang di Linux kita. Kali ini saya menggunakan Debian 7 dan akan saya pasang repositori local di harddisknya. Repositori yang akan saya gunakan ini merupakan 3 file ISO yang terpisah. Ok, langsung saja tutorialnya.

1. Pertama, Siapkan 3 file ISO yang merupakan repositori dari Debian 7. Disini saya menyimpan 3 file ISO saya di direktori home/repo dengan nama masing-masing dvd1.iso, dvd2.iso, dan dvd3.iso.

2. Kedua, buat sebuah folder. Agar bisa di akses oleh pengguna lain, saya akan membuat folder di /var/www. Jadi, pengguna lain dapat menggunakan repo local lewat layanan Web server. Sehingga aktifkan layanan Webserver dengan menginstall Apache2. kemudian buat folder di /var/www/ sesuaikan dengan jumlah file iso.
root@repo:~# mkdir /var/www/repo1
root@repo:~# mkdir /var/www/repo2
root@repo:~# mkdir /var/www/repo3
3. Buka file fstap di direktori /etc. masukkan perintah berikut untuk membuka file
root@repo:~# nano /etc/fstab
Tambahkan baris perintah berikut didalam file fstab.
 /home/repo/dvd1.iso /var/www/repo1/ udf,iso9660 loop 0 0
/home/repo/dvd2.iso /var/www/repo2/ udf,iso9660 loop 0 0
/home/repo/dvd3.iso /var/www/repo3/ udf,iso9660 loop 0 0
 ket:
  /home/repo/dvd1.iso => tempat file iso berada.
  /var/www/repo1/ => folder yang dibuat dilangkah kedua

4. Buka file sources.list di direktori /etc/apt. masukkan perintah berikut untuk membuka file.
root@repo:~# nano /etc/apt/sources.list
tambahkan tanda pagar "#" di depan perintah yang masih aktif (tandanya masih berwana selain biru). dan tambahkan perintah berikut:
deb file:/var/www/repo wheezy main contrib
deb file:/var/www/repo1 wheezy main contrib
deb file:/var/www/repo2 wheezy main contrib
5. Kemudian mount folder masing-masing direktori yang telah kita buat di langkah ke2.
root@repo:~# mount /var/www/repo1
root@repo:~# mount /var/www/repo2
root@repo:~# mount /var/www/repo3
6. Kemudian lakukan update
root@repo:~# apt-get update

Nah.. sekarang kita bisa menggunakan Repositori yang telah kita buat. untuk pengguna lain, dapat memasukkan perintah berikut pada file sources.list.
deb http://172.20.9.3/repo1/debian/ wheezy main contrib
deb http://172.20.9.3/repo2/debian/ wheezy main contrib
deb http://172.20.9.3/repo3/debian/ wheezy main contrib 
Jika sudah tinggal Update.

Oke, Repositori lokal berhasil dibuat. terima kasih talah berkunjung, semoga bermanfat.

Post a Comment

0 Comments